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8434014 907896 1191683 659 890
44380050649 37
44380050649 37
26354 691665 5579119038 0589405
All about undefined
Interested in learning more?
44380050649 37
26354 691665 5579119038 0589405
See more
14552737083 06614467
1681030 63724482537 257997
See more
10602 95392
835 519522 3783
See more